Description

We are seeking a sharp, execution-driven Operations Associate to join the team at Pheratech Systems. This role is critical to helping the company scale: across internal ops, growth, B2B execution, and special projects. You’ll work directly with the CEO and act as a force multiplier for high-priority initiatives.
The ideal candidate is former military, detail-oriented, calm under pressure, and hungry to grow into a Chief of Staff or strategic leadership role. If you’re looking for exposure to every part of a startup from fundraising to federal contracts to autonomous systems: this is the role.

EXPERIENCE

  • Prior experience in military operations, leadership, or strategic planning preferred
  • Experience working in startups, defense, autonomy, or logistics-heavy environments is a plus
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ills required — you’ll be writing on behalf of the founder and the company
  • Familiarity with internal ops, CRM tools, project management systems, and fast-paced environments
  • Bonus if you’ve worked on external-facing projects (e.g. partnerships, gov capture, GTM, BD, or customer success)
  • Comfortable with ambiguity, pressure, and speed — we operate in startup time
  • High-trust, low-ego, execution-first mindset — you lead by doing
Responsibilities
  • Lead daily operations, ensuring internal projects, workflows, and priorities stay aligned and on track
  • Drive external execution, including B2B pipeline building, partnership outreach, and coordination with key customers and agencies
  • Handle investor and board prep, including materials, metrics tracking, and follow-ups
  • Own logistics across hiring, scheduling, product testing, event coordination, and operational systems
  • Collaborate with technical, marketing, and field teams to ensure execution across product rollouts and deployments
  • Draft communications: internal memos, investor updates, pitch content, and operational documentation
  • Support growth ops, including CRM upkeep, lead tracking, and product feedback from customers and field pilots
  • Manage early vendor relationships, onboarding, and contracts
  • Support product and deployment cycles, including testing coordination, logistics, and special projects
  • Run special projects as needed: from DHS proposal drafts to field gear sourcing to process design
